Helping with the gardening
After being picked from the roadhouse the night before. It quite nise to be back at Middalya. All the kids had had a great time while they had been away, all the adults were pretty much knackered. But everyone was pleased to be back.

Over the next week I spent most of my time doing the gardening or cleaning cars as well my normal jobs. The weather was still hot, well above 40 degrees. Also there was a cyclone building in the north, that was heading west out to sea and then expected to turn and come back down the west coast. This could cause problems. so from the weekend onwards there was constant checking what the weather forcast was up to, and what the predictions were for the cyclone. By Tuesday the cyclone was still following the path that had been predicted. Which would mean that Middalya was in it's path. So,in all likelyhood the station would be cut by flood water that would come with the cyclone. So they were preparing to batten down the hatchs.

As I was suppose to be meeting Richie down in Perth the following week. It was decided that I should head down before the cyclone hit and I ended up stuck there. So after a phone call to Greyhound to check that the bus would still be running the following evening, I would be heading down to Perth a week earlier than expected.

Up untill about five hours before the bus came the cyclone was heading on its predicted route down the west coast. Then at the last minute turned at a right angle and headed in land in stead. Still I was lucky that a bus would be coming as the south bound bus had been stopped up in Broome. Fortunatley the north bound bus was only coming up as far as Minilya Roadhouse before turning around and heading south.

When the cyclone George hit the coast at port headland it was a catagory 4. It caused some pretty severe damage, before it deflated as it headed inland.

Anyway the most I saw of it was the cloud patterns in the sky. Which were pretty cool. Apart from that it was pretty unadventful 15 hour bus journey back to Perth.
